#8d6046 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8d6046 is composed of 55.3% red, 37.6%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 31.9% magenta, 50.4% yellow and 44.7% black. It has a hue angle of 22 degrees, a saturation of 33.6% and a lightness of 41.4%. #8d6046 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c08c with #1b0000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

Shades and Tints of #8d6046
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0705 is the darkest color, while #fdfcfc is the lightest one.
